[SCM] libav/experimental: Fix compilation with --disable-yasm. 10l to me.

siretart at users.alioth.debian.org siretart at users.alioth.debian.org
Sun Jun 30 17:13:09 UTC 2013


The following commit has been merged in the experimental branch:
commit 0913a92a59cc5a63c0a1d336c86e62d8c67828c5
Author: Vitor Sessak <vitor1001 at gmail.com>
Date:   Sat Jul 31 16:17:54 2010 +0000

    Fix compilation with --disable-yasm. 10l to me.
    
    Originally committed as revision 24617 to svn://svn.ffmpeg.org/ffmpeg/trunk

diff --git a/libavcodec/imgconvert.c b/libavcodec/imgconvert.c
index 1fb8f7e..2159216 100644
--- a/libavcodec/imgconvert.c
+++ b/libavcodec/imgconvert.c
@@ -38,7 +38,7 @@
 #include "libavutil/pixdesc.h"
 #include "libavcore/imgutils.h"
 
-#if HAVE_MMX
+#if HAVE_MMX && HAVE_YASM
 #include "x86/dsputil_mmx.h"
 #endif
 
@@ -54,7 +54,7 @@
 #define FF_PIXEL_PACKED   1 /**< only one components containing all the channels */
 #define FF_PIXEL_PALETTE  2  /**< one components containing indexes for a palette */
 
-#if HAVE_MMX
+#if HAVE_MMX && HAVE_YASM
 #define deinterlace_line_inplace ff_deinterlace_line_inplace_mmx
 #define deinterlace_line         ff_deinterlace_line_mmx
 #else
@@ -1126,7 +1126,7 @@ int img_get_alpha_info(const AVPicture *src,
     return ret;
 }
 
-#if !HAVE_MMX
+#if !(HAVE_MMX && HAVE_YASM)
 /* filter parameters: [-1 4 2 4 -1] // 8 */
 static void deinterlace_line_c(uint8_t *dst,
                              const uint8_t *lum_m4, const uint8_t *lum_m3,

-- 
Libav/FFmpeg packaging



More information about the pkg-multimedia-commits mailing list